# Nest CLI 설치 $ npm i -g @nestjs/cli # nest new {프로젝트명} $ nest new nest-server
$ npm i $ npm run start

FROM node WORKDIR /app COPY . . RUN npm install RUN npm run build EXPOSE 3000 ENTRYPOINT [ "node", "dist/main.js" ]
node_modules
$ docker build -t nest-server .
$ docker image ls
apiVersion: v1 kind: Pod metadata: name: nest-pod spec: containers: - name: nest-container image: nest-server imagePullPolicy: IfNotPresent
$ kubectl apply -f nest-pod.yaml
$ kubectl get pods

$ kubectl port-forward nest-pod 3000:3000

$ kubectl delete pod nest-pod